The positions you have outlined here, are persuasive. Yet still, with this better fit, timewise, an even count still remains difficult, as counting the "day" of crucifixion as a day "in the earth" seems problematic to me, being as they had to hurry just to get all the preparations done before sundown.

If they only beat the sun disappearing over the Western horizon by say (for discussion's sake) an half-hour or so, possibly less --- would that still count as a "day"?

If not, and one could somehow reasonably push the crucifixion back yet another day, with the next somewhat mid-week day being on of those "extra" Sabbaths, then the count gets too long by half a day or so...?

In normal usage, the term “day” is normally understood to be either a part of, or an entire day.

Backing the crucifixion to Wednesday, or having it on Friday, cannot acocunt for 3 days and 3 nights. Wednesday makes too much and Firday makes too little.

AN interesting not eis the context of the Matt 12 prophecy, seems to be that the Pharisees asked for a sign and Jesus said that the only sign given would be that the Son of Man would be as Jonah, 3 dyas and 3 nights in the eart. SO to my ears and logic it would seem that this was a prophecy to be taken literally, not figuartively, because it was meant to be a conformation of Jesus’ diviniyt. Just my thoughts.
